Answer: The Houston Aphasia Recovery Center was conceived in 2008 to address a conspicuous void in Houston's medical services community. As the fourth-largest city in the country, Houston has one of the most respected medical centers in the world, yet nothing existed for long-term recovery and wellness for people with aphasia, their families and caregivers. All that changed on February 2, 2010. HARC opened its doors with programs for participants with aphasia, their caregivers, families and volunteers. The entry point for new participants and caregivers is the Introductory Program that evaluates communication ability and provides techniques for communicating with people with aphasia. The first step is simple: Simply call for more information and to set up a tour of our facility. After the screening process is complete, you will participate in the Introductory Program. After that, you and your caregiver will be part of the HARC family. Our Wellness Program helps build language skills and provides practice for understanding and being understood in a safe, fun environment. The computer lab helps participants answer email, use the Internet, and practice language skills using aphasia-friendly software. There's a large community room for socializing, playing games or enjoying a cup of coffee with conversation. You can bring a lunch and visit with friends old and new. We're open Tuesdays, Wednesdays, and Thursdays for programs from 9:30 a.m. to 2:30 p.m. Mondays are by appointment only.
